As per the EC\u2019s investigation, who is Facebook threatening to shut out? And, do Trump\u2019s ramblings have any merit, meaning Facebook\u2019s plan will be ultimately foiled?<\/p>\n<p>Mukul Krishna, global head of practice, digital media at Frost and Sullivan, doesn\u2019t think so.<\/p>\n<p>Speaking to Mobile World Live, Krishna believes the scrutiny over Libra is largely expected, considering \u201cthe history of scandals Facebook has had to face over the years regarding consumer data\u201d, but ultimately it will eventually launch.<\/p>\n<p>Crucially, though, Facebook will have to make sure there are no repeats of its recent missteps with its ambitious payments plan.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e cryptocurrency market is volatile and to make sure Facebook increases its probability of success, it needs to be thorough about data security, encryption and financial backing among a myriad of other issues.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Considering what Facebook is actually trying to do, which could see a shake-up of the financial sector as a whole if successful, Krishna noted \u201cit would be surprising if it were less challenging\u201d to launch, particularly because of the company&#8217;s access to a massive amount of consumer data.<\/p>\n<p>Operator impact<br \/>\nWhile Libra, as a cryptocurrency, wii compete with the likes of Bitcoin, Ethereum et al, perhaps more pertinent for the mobile industry will be the competition the payments platform will create for already established mobile money players, such as Safaricom, MTN and Airtel, to name a few.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It will be disruptive for incumbents,\u201d believes Krishna. \u201cOnce Libra is introduced to the existing ecosystem it may simplify currency exchange across international markets.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Ruomeng Wang, research and analysis manager &#8211; fintech and blockchain intelligence services at IHS Markit, concurred, tipping Facebook\u2019s already established reach to ensure that Libra increases adoption across the mobile payments sector.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cFacebook has launched P2P payments in some markets, the integration of Libra wallets into WhatsApp and Messenger services will further increase the acceptability of digital currency and mobile money,\u201d she said.<\/p>\n<p>The blockchain debate<br \/>\nFacebook\u2019s dive into cryptocurrency and mobile payments again brings blockchain to the forefront, with the technology tipped to play a major role for operators in the future.<\/p>\n<p>However, at this year\u2019s MWC Barcelona on a panel I hosted, US operator Sprint\u2019s SVP of IoT Ivo Rook suggested the very obvious link between blockchain and cryptocurrency could impact the former negatively.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cBecause of the encryption, these two are strongly intercorrelated. Ironically, cryptocurrency doesn&#8217;t have a positive correlation to it. Cryptocurrency is associated with risk, while blockchain is there to take the risk out. So I think there is a lot of education to be done,\u201d said Rook back in February.<\/p>\n<p>Frost and Sullivan&#8217;s Krishna believes blockchain has \u201cmoved much further along\u201d, and while there will always be nefarious use cases for the technology, the potential benefits it provides far outweighs the downside.<\/p>\n<p>The tussle between regulators and the market will however not go away anytime soon. \u201cRegulators will try and flex their muscles to remove some of the anonymity and make crypto transactions more transparent,\u201d he said.<\/p>\n<p>Libra in limbo<br \/>\nFor now, Facebook remains in something of a limbo.
